package com.google.devtools.build.lib.syntax;
import com.google.common.base.Joiner;
import com.google.devtools.build.lib.vfs.PathFragment;
import java.io.IOException;
import javax.annotation.Nullable;
/** An abstraction for reading input from a file or taking it as a pre-cooked char[] or String. */
// TODO(adonovan): make this final and concrete;
// create returns the only implementation that matters.
// TODO(adonovan): rename to "ParserInput".
public abstract class ParserInputSource {
protected ParserInputSource() {}
/** Returns the content of the input source. */
public abstract char[] getContent();
/**
* Returns the (non-null) path of the input source. Note: Once constructed, this object will never
* re-read the content from path.
*/
// TODO(adonovan): use Strings, to avoid dependency on vfs; but first we need to avoid depending
// on events.Location.
public abstract PathFragment getPath();
/** Returns an unnamed input source that reads from a list of strings, joined by newlines. */
public static ParserInputSource fromLines(String... lines) {
return create(Joiner.on("\n").join(lines), null);
}
/**
* Returns an import source that reads from a Latin-1 encoded byte array. The path specifies the
* name of the file, for use in source locations and error messages; a null path implies the empty
* string.
*/
public static ParserInputSource create(byte[] bytes, @Nullable PathFragment path)
throws IOException {
char[] content = convertFromLatin1(bytes);
return create(content, path);
}
/**
* Create an input source from the given content, and associate path with this source. Path will
* be used in error messages etc. but we will *never* attempt to read the content from path. A
* null path implies the empty string.
*/
public static ParserInputSource create(String content, @Nullable PathFragment path) {
return create(content.toCharArray(), path);
}
/**
* Create an input source from the given content, and associate path with
* this source. Path will be used in error messages etc. but we will *never*
* attempt to read the content from path.
*/
public static ParserInputSource create(final char[] content, final PathFragment path) {
return new ParserInputSource() {
@Override
public char[] getContent() {
return content;
}
@Override
public PathFragment getPath() {
return path == null ? PathFragment.EMPTY_FRAGMENT : path;
}
};
}
private static char[] convertFromLatin1(byte[] content) {
char[] latin1 = new char[content.length];
for (int i = 0; i < latin1.length; i++) { // yeah, latin1 is this easy! :-)
latin1[i] = (char) (0xff & content[i]);
}
return latin1;
}
}
